Application Criteria

You can apply for an excellence scholarship if you fulfil the following criteria:

  • You are an international student at HAW Hamburg.
  • You obtained your higher education entrance qualification abroad or you have completed preparatory studies at a German Studienkolleg.
  • You have completed at least two semesters (for bachelor’s students) or one semester (for master’s students) at HAW Hamburg and are still within the standard period of study (generally Regelstudienzeit) of your degree course.
  • You are not receiving BAföG or other government funding.
  • Your average grade is at least 2.2.

Duration And Amount Funding

The excellence scholarships are awards of at least €1,800 and are granted for one semester.

Residency Permits

Students with residency status under Section 16 of the Federal Residency Act (residency for study) and EU citizens are eligible to apply for the scholarships issued by the International Office if they are not eligible for BAföG or other state funding. International students who are refugees cannot apply for these scholarships. International students with a different residency status can only apply in exceptional cases, following clarification of their situation.

Selection Process

Once all of the applications have been reviewed, applicants will be allocated points based on their average grades, the average number of credit points per semester, and the letters of reference. This ranking will serve as a guide for the selection committee. Other criteria, such as the student’s financial situation or whether they have already received the scholarship, will also be considered. In the case of students who have already received a scholarship, the committee will assess whether their performance has improved relative to the previous application.

Multiple Scholarships

Receiving other scholarships in addition to an excellence scholarship is not permitted. However, you can apply for multiple scholarships to increase your chances of receiving funding.

Volunteer Program

Volunteer activity is not a criterion for an Excellence Scholarship. However, instructors can note particular academic engagement—for example, in projects or events—in their letters of reference. If you have undertaken international activities on a volunteer basis at HAW Hamburg, you can apply for a scholarship for exceptionally socially committed students.

Funding Duration

You can receive an excellence scholarship for a maximum of 2 years (4 semesters). Additionally, you can apply for a scholarship for highly committed students.

Required Documents

  • CV (maximum of 2 pages)
  • Certificate of enrolment from my
  • Current transcript from myHAW with information about average grade and completed credit points
  • For students whose average grade and credit points are not listed in their transcript (this currently applies to all degree courses in the Faculty of Engineering and Computer Science, except Automotive Engineering, Aeronautical Engineering and Mechanical Engineering), the International Office will request the average grade and credit points from the FSB after the application deadline.
  • Copy of your residency permit (non-EU citizens) or a copy of your passport or personal ID card (EU citizens)
  • Bank account information form
  • Financial circumstances form
